KNSBackend: Do not accept global searches

Make sure we only show search results from KNewStuff when the user is actively browsing a KNS category (Plasma or Apps add-ons).

This better matches the general user expectation of only reporting app searches by default, when searching from Home and no category is selected.

I think this is an easy low-hanging fruit we can take now with a relative consensus, solving the vast majority of user complains about the Store content in discover. Then other steps or approaches being discussed in #30 can have less user/time-pressure for a better desired result.

BUG: 493047
FIXED-IN: 6.4.0

BEFORE (From "Home") discover-global-search-before-home
AFTER (From "Home") discover-global-search-after-home
AFTER (From "Plasma Add-ons") discover-global-search-after-plasma

Merge request reports

Loading